June 9,2004 <br /> The regular meeting of the Everett City Council was called to order at 8:30 <br /> am.,June 9.2004,In the City Council Chambers of the Everett City Hall, <br /> President Hattie presiding. Upon roll call it was found that Mayor <br /> Stephenson:Council Members Krell,Olson,Hatloe,Gipson,Campbell, <br /> Stonecipher,end Overstreet were present. <br /> Council Member Olson led the Pledge of Allegiance. <br /> The minutes of the June 2,2004 City Council meeting were approved as <br /> printed.Council Member Campbell abstained from the vote. <br /> COUNCIL <br /> Council Member Gipson remarked that he participated in the dunk tank at <br /> the Police Unity Basketball Game. <br /> President Halloo announced that action item no.11,to set June t6,2004 <br /> as the date to consider acceptance of the 10%petition and notice of intent <br /> submitted by John Kenny far the Kenny Annexation,has been pulled from <br /> the agenda. <br /> CITY ATTORNEY <br /> City Attorney Iles requested an executive session regarding four litigation <br /> manes. <br /> CITIZEN COMMENTS <br /> Dan Bovey,4619 Baker Drive.expressed concem regarding the possible <br /> removal of the Ten Commandments monument. <br /> David Gibson,P.O.Box 871,Camaro Island,Seattle Rod-Tiques, <br /> thanked the council members for allowing them to hold their cat show end <br /> barbecue cook-of in the City of Everett. He remarked that they raised <br /> $18,800.00 for local charities. <br /> 183 <br />
